Supply chain scheduling with deadlines

This paper considers a make-to-order production-distribution system with one supplier and multiple customers. A set of orders with deadlines needs to be processed by the supplier and delivered to the customers upon completion. The supplier can process one order at a time without preemption. Each customer is at a distinct location and only orders from the same customer can be batched together for delivery. Each delivery shipment has a capacity limit and incurs a distribution cost. The problem is to find a joint schedule of order processing at the supplier and order delivery from the supplier to the customers that minimize the total distribution cost with deadline constraint. We study the solvability of three cases of the problem by providing efficient algorithms.
